Apple took a significant step into the Chinese market earlier this week when it set up an official store on the Chinese e-commerce site Tmall. This site, operated by e-commerce goliath Alibaba, is currently the second largest online retailer, and according to analysis firm Euromonitor International, is Amazon.com's premier source of competition. In fact, the firm predicts that Tmall will overtake Amazon's reign by 2015. This new move in Apple's expansion plan will surely serve as an important step to help the company gain even more ground abroad and in the realms of e-commerce.
